Origin and history

The church of Saint-Roch de L'Étrat is a religious monument located in the commune of L'Étrat, in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region. The available data do not specify its construction period or the architectural or historical details associated with it. His name suggests a connection with Saint Roch, often invoked against epidemics, but no source confirms this dedication or its context.

Parish churches, such as L'Étrat, traditionally played a central role in the lives of rural communities. They served as a place of worship, assembly and identity marker for the inhabitants. In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, these buildings often reflect local history, mixing religious, social and sometimes economic influences, although the specificities of this church are not documented in the available sources.
